Output e3b23b2bc8ba4226442823c9231e079751f72a8d0a51c095d2c89ba12ae0f63d:1

value
6936189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d55b20b8a8fa7dfa6fd8e77e29d7e10df1bbd6 OP_EQUAL
address
3DtfPHkxQs7t8qTu1s1whRW8Gv6nzXxCdg
transaction
e3b23b2bc8ba4226442823c9231e079751f72a8d0a51c095d2c89ba12ae0f63d